Senior Brazilian and United States Marines, and their staffs, pose for a photo outside of the Brazilian Marine Corps Division Headquarters at the start of Exercise UNITAS LXIII at Ilha do Governador, Rio de Janeiro, Sept. 6, 2022. UNITAS, which is Latin for “unity,” was conceived in 1959 and has taken place annually since first conducted in 1960. This year marks the 63rd iteration of the world’s longest-running annual multinational maritime exercise. Additionally, this year Brazil will celebrate its bicentennial, a historical milestone commemorating 200 years of the country’s independence. (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Maj. Jeremy Wheeler)
